Output d66d8f91ff89f9de0312ef4979b87353de561c0a80ebe2502a204a5a9cc56cc5:35

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 68e2595a86b14d6680ad5f18b49e46b3a19268f5
address
tb1qdr39jk5xk9xkdq9dtuvtf8jxkwsey6845edvn0
transaction
d66d8f91ff89f9de0312ef4979b87353de561c0a80ebe2502a204a5a9cc56cc5
spent
true